### Step 7: Retry failed exports

After cutover, some Harrowfield export jobs will be stuck in `failed` from the window when the old endpoint was down. Do not re-run the full pipeline. Query the `export_jobs` table for rows failed within the migration window, confirm each has no partial output file, then flip status to `pending`. The scheduler picks them up within five minutes. Retries use the same scoped credentials as before. Connect to the exports database with the string below.

primary connection of kahof-kagep = mssql://belath_svc:3uqY4g6LHG5Nyi@db-d0ba.ferralabs.corp:5432/rusdor

Runbook: Skylark Relay websocket reconnect loop. Clients drop after the 60s idle cutoff, then reconnect without re-presenting the session ticket, so the Fenwick auth layer issues a fresh unauthenticated channel. Mitigation: force ticket revalidation on every reconnect and cap retries at five. No credential exposure observed, but review the handshake logs. The affected build is identified by the token recorded below.

pipeline stamp: htk9_ce63042d9

## TKT-4471: Signature check failed on lagguard deploy

The lagguard read-replica lag alarm package failed signature verification on the Pell staging nodes, blocking the 2.3 rollout. Cause: the package was signed with the retired January key after rotation. Fix: re-sign and redeploy; alarm thresholds unchanged. For future maintainers, the correct current signing key is recorded below.

signing key of bagap-yawep = bky13_TbfT6ZMUoGJo2